Hemiptera, or true bugs, like aphids and cicadas, are known for this. Mosquitos too, belonging to the Diptera, together with flies! And even some species of moth have developed a taste for blood and piercing mouthparts.

It depends on how fast your body heals, and how long you have had the piercing. The longer you have had the piercing, the longer it will take to close. This is true for all piercings.

Alcohol can get into the piercing and en flame the new tissue trying to form, so yes it can irritate the piercing until the piercing becomes more seasoned (toughened).
